Bursting Strength Tester: A Comprehensive Guide

Wiki Article

A pop strength tester unit is a vital instrument used in a variety of industries to determine the capacity of a sheet to endure sudden force before it fails . This test is particularly crucial for packaging materials, fiber products, and textiles , ensuring their reliability under practical situations . The process generally involves applying growing hydraulic load until the specimen undergoes a failure , and the reading is expressed in units like PSI .

Tear Tensile Machine Verification and Maintenance

To guarantee precise tear strength test results, periodic verification and servicing of the device is vital. Verification typically involves comparing the device's readings against a known reference and undertaking any required adjustments. Regular servicing should encompass checking elements like the holding apparatus, pneumatic power mechanism, and display for damage.

Neglecting these procedures can lead to inaccurate results, greater repair costs, and a reduced evaluation of sample integrity.

The Importance of Bursting Strength Testing in Quality Control

Bursting strength evaluation plays a essential role in maintaining item performance during the creation system. It includes placing a material to abrupt stress until it breaks. This method is notably important for materials like bags , cloth, and films used in wrapping applications. Bursting strength evaluation offers useful data regarding the component's potential to resist shipping and application conditions . Rupture in this sector can result in goods spoilage, buyer frustration , and potential responsibility . Therefore, implementing bursting strength evaluation into a comprehensive quality control system is critical for companies seeking to provide trustworthy and safe products.
